OverviewBobby woke up late with the realisation he had been found guilty. He has to start his community service. The Sheriff is not amused at Bobby's lateness. Bobby flies to the edge of the wood and turns left. He watches sea eagles fishing, keeping one eye open for those who would like to have Bobby as their dinner. He meets up with the 'old crow' and forms an immediate friendship. Bobby stays too long listening to her stories. He does not know the way back and gets lost. He is late in reporting back and his report is not good enough. Bobby flies to the food table and has to tell the hedgerow birds what has happened to him. With a feeling of sadness he returns to his temporary nest. Worried about his image and not being late again makes him have a very disturbed nights sleep.
